本文目錄導讀:
CSS選擇器詳解及其應用
CSS選擇器是用于選擇頁面元素的關鍵工具,通過不同的選擇器,我們可以***地定位到需要樣式的HTML元素,本文將詳細介紹CSS選擇器的種類、特性及其應用場景。
CSS選擇器概述
CSS選擇器是一種模式,用于匹配頁面中的元素,根據選擇器的不同,我們可以對單個元素或多個元素應用樣式,CSS選擇器具有高度的靈活性和強大的功能,可以幫助我們實現(xiàn)各種復雜的樣式需求。
CSS選擇器的種類及應用
1、元素選擇器:通過HTML元素類型選擇,如div
、p
等。
2、類選擇器:通過類屬性選擇,以.
開頭,如.myClass
。
3、ID選擇器:通過元素的***ID選擇,以#
開頭,如#myID
。
4、屬性選擇器:選擇具有指定屬性的元素,如[type="text"]
。
5、偽類選擇器:選擇處于特定狀態(tài)的元素,如:hover
、:active
等。
6、偽元素選擇器:選擇元素的特定部分,如::before
、::after
。
7、組合選擇器:通過組合上述選擇器,可以更***地選擇元素,如div.myClass
、#myID p
等。
如何使用CSS選擇器
在CSS中,我們可以通過以下步驟使用選擇器:
1、識別需要應用樣式的HTML元素。
2、選擇合適的選擇器類型。
3、在CSS規(guī)則中使用選擇器指定元素,并應用樣式。
注意事項
1、選擇器的特異性:在沖突情況下,特異性更高的選擇器將優(yōu)先應用樣式。
2、選擇器的性能:為了優(yōu)化性能,應盡量避免使用過于復雜的選擇器。
3、選擇器的兼容性:不同瀏覽器對選擇器的支持程度可能有所不同,需要注意兼容性問題。
CSS選擇器是CSS的核心功能之一,掌握選擇器的使用方法對于實現(xiàn)各種復雜的樣式需求***關重要,本文詳細介紹了CSS選擇器的種類、特性及應用場景,希望能對讀者有所幫助。